About Angleton Christian School Corporation

Angleton Christian School Corporation (EIN: 203202465) is a nonprofit organization based in Angleton, TX, classified under NTEE code B20. The organization reported total revenue of $4.1M and total assets of $9.3M according to its most recent IRS 990 filing. Angleton Christian School Corporation is a mid-size nonprofit that has been operating for 17 years, with 12 years of IRS 990 filings on record (2012–2023). Revenue has grown at a compound annual rate of 16.6%.

Key Financial Metrics (2023)

From the most recent IRS 990 filing on record:

Total Revenue$4.0M
Total Expenses$3.5M
Surplus / Deficit+$529K
Total Assets$9.5M
Total Liabilities$4.8M
Net Assets$4.7M
Operating Margin13.3%
Debt-to-Asset Ratio50.2%
Months of Reserves33.1 months

Financial Health Grade: A

In 2023, Angleton Christian School Corporation reported a surplus of $529K with revenue exceeding expenses, holds 33.1 months of operating reserves (strong position), has a debt-to-asset ratio of 50.2% (high leverage).

Angleton Christian School Corporation demonstrates a generally stable financial position with consistent revenue growth over the past decade, increasing from $1,193,702 in 2014 to $3,983,855 in 2023. The organization consistently operates with a surplus, as seen in 2023 where revenue was $3,983,855 against expenses of $3,455,240, indicating sound financial management. Their asset base has also grown significantly, from $1,008,922 in 2014 to $9,527,831 in 2023, suggesting good stewardship of resources and investment in their mission. The organization's spending efficiency appears strong, with expenses consistently lower than revenue, allowing for asset accumulation. A key aspect of their transparency is the consistent reporting of 0% officer compensation across all available filings, which is a positive indicator for a nonprofit of this size. While specific program, administrative, and fundraising expense breakdowns are not provided in the summary data, the overall financial health suggests a well-managed entity. However, without detailed functional expense breakdowns (e.g., program service expenses vs. administrative and fundraising), a complete assessment of spending efficiency is limited. The consistent growth in assets and revenue, coupled with no reported officer compensation, points towards a financially healthy and responsibly managed organization, though more granular expense data would enhance transparency.

Filing History

IRS 990 filing history for Angleton Christian School Corporation showing financial trends over 12 years of public records:

Over 12 years of IRS 990 filings (2012–2023), Angleton Christian School Corporation's revenue has grown by 442.9%, moving from $734K to $4.0M. Total assets increased by 1099.1% over the same period, from $795K to $9.5M. Total functional expenses rose by 401.7%, from $689K to $3.5M. In its most recent filing year (2023), Angleton Christian School Corporation reported a surplus of $529K, with revenue exceeding expenses. The organization holds $4.8M in liabilities against $9.5M in assets (debt-to-asset ratio: 50.2%), resulting in net assets of $4.7M.

Data Sources and Methodology

This transparency report for Angleton Christian School Corporation is generated by NonprofitSpending's AI analysis engine. The data is sourced from publicly available IRS 990 filings accessed through the ProPublica Nonprofit Explorer API and IRS electronic filing records. The Mission Score, spending breakdown, and other analytical insights are produced by artificial intelligence and should be used as one of multiple factors when evaluating a nonprofit organization.

IRS 990 forms are annual information returns that most tax-exempt organizations must file with the IRS. These forms provide detailed financial information including revenue, expenses, assets, liabilities, and compensation of officers. NonprofitSpending processes this data to provide accessible transparency reports for donors, researchers, and the general public.
